Whenever any words and phrases are used in this chapter, the meaning respectively ascribed to them in N.J.S.A. 39:1-1 shall be deemed to apply to such words and phrases used herein.
Whenever certain hours are named in this chapter, they shall mean either Eastern standard time (EST) or Eastern daylight saving time (EDST) as may be in current use.
No person shall disobey or fail to follow the order, direction or other signal of any police officer, New Jersey State Trooper or other properly authorized law enforcement official within the Township, nor shall any persons disobey or fail to follow the traffic instruction(s) on any properly posted traffic control device and/or signal within the Township of Buena Vista.
Any vehicle parked in violation of this chapter shall be deemed a nuisance and a menace to the safe and proper regulation of traffic, and any police officer may provide for the removal of such vehicle. The owner shall bear the reasonable costs of removal and storage which may result from such removal before regaining possession of the vehicle.
All former traffic ordinances of the Township of Buena Vista are hereby repealed, except that this repeal shall not affect nor prevent the prosecution or punishment of any person for any act done or committed in violation of any ordinance hereby repealed prior to the taking effect of this chapter.
If any part or parts of this chapter are held to be invalid for any reason, such decision shall not affect the validity of the remaining portions of this chapter.
Unless another penalty is expressly provided by New Jersey statute or except as specifically provided in some other section of this chapter, every person convicted of a violation of a provision of this chapter or any supplement thereto shall be liable to a penalty of not less than $20 but not more than $250 or imprisonment for a term not exceeding 15 days, or both.
